i have a 1988 e70elcca S/N g1800349. I have done a rebuild on the carbs and it still doesnt idle good sometimes. I have the factory service manual and to do the link and sync i use method B. i did the throttle valve sync which included moving the throttle cam follower away form the cam, Then i did the idle speed adjustment, then the throttle cam follower adjustment. What I dont understand is how can the idle be set first then when doing the throttle cam adj you have to have .005 clearance between the cam and follower. HOW CAN IT IDLE IF THERE IS CLEARANCE BETWEEN THE LINKAGE?? I hope i am just missing something here

Re: 1988 70 idle problems

the throttle valves stay shut at idle -- idle speed adjustment is all spark timing.
